Finn’s Pair Poised For Perfect Finish

08:01 05 November 2025
GRNSW News
Gets Late Early and Both Bowers Ace, who have won a combined 27 races at the track and earned a total of more than $634,000, are poised to fill the quinella in Thursday night's Mark Hughes Foundation Free-For-All at Wentworth Park.

Speedy Pie, a last start all-the-way Wentworth Park winner in 29.78, looks sure to be the pacemaker from box four but the Minnie Finn-trained litter siblings, Gets Late Early (box eight) and Both Bowers Ace (box seven) should get the perfect "trail" courtesy of the small field of six.

Both Bowers Ace and especially Gets Late Early race well from wide draws, with Both Bowers Ace having clocked a smart 29.36 from box seven over 515m at Gosford and Gets Late Early posting her fastest Wenty figures of 29.45, after jumping from box six 12 months ago.

Both Bowers Ace is coming off successive third placings behind Canya Brew It and Speedy Pie at Wentworth Park while Gets Late Early's most recent outing was a fifth to Travelling Gem in the Goulburn Fireball final, over the unsuitable 350m journey.

In her most recent Wentworth Park performance Gets Late Early chased home Jungle Johnny, jumping from box four and clocking 29.77, in finishing a distant second to the Mark Gatt-trained star.

Mark Gatt has two starters in Thursday's Ladbrokes Srm In Multis one win 520m fifth grade, in the shape of last start winner Wyndra All Heart and his litter sister Wyndra All Smoke.

Wyndra All Smoke won her maiden race at WP in 30.23 on October 17 while Wyndra All Heart clocked a slick 29.67 winning his maiden event last Saturday night.

Gatt confirmed that Wyndra All Heart is "definitely" faster than Wyndra All Smoke.

"Although Wyndra All Smoke has good early pace and is better than her 30.23 maiden win suggests, Wyndra All Heart is definitely a much quicker greyhound,'' Gatt declared.

But Gatt concedes that although this is a single win fifth grade, it won't be easy, with Wentworth Park newcomers Nebular Stratus (box five) and Loco Dominator (box seven) showing outstanding ability at Nowra and Maitland respectively.

Kiando Florence, who broke the Muswellbrook 431m record last Thursday, will tackle 520m and Wentworth Park for the first time in Thursday's fifth grade Ladbrokes Fast Payout Stakes.

Trainer Chris Edwards said: "Kiando Florence has not seen Wentworth Park before but she trialled well enough in a post-to-post hit-out at Dubbo to indicate she has a good chance.

"Although she is stepping up an extra 89m on her Muswellbrook record run, she had to go a further 150m into the catching pen after her race there so she is fit enough.

"Kiando Florence is going so well I thought we'd have a throw at the stumps.''

Trainer Jenny Brown believes Angelic Angel can improve on her first-up second placing at Wentworth Park last Thursday if she can make the pace in this week's Ladbrokes Bet Ticker 520m fifth grade.

"Angelic Angel had clocked a nippy 24.17 in a post-to-post trial at Wentworth Park before last week's race and while I was not disappointed by her finishing second, she was unable to lead in that race and she is a much better greyhound when she can get on the lure.''

Angelic Angel's hardest rival could be the Darren Sultana-trained Little Granny, who set up a big early lead before tiring badly in the straight when fourth at Wentworth Park last Thursday.

Owner Gordon Sciberras said: "I was surprised Little Granny got run down when she got so far in front, especially when she missed a place after still leading in the straight.

"But the track was a bit heavy and I think she should go better this week.''

Sciberras is part-owner of the Vic Sultana-trained Night Agent, and gives that dog a good chance in Thursday's Ladbrokes Sports Bar 520m fifth grade.

Night Agent chased his kennelmate Billy Ray's Girl from start to finish at Wentworth Park last Thursday and Sciberras is pleased with his dog's box two draw this week.

"Night Agent wants an inside box and he is going well at present,'' Sciberras said.

"You never know, one night he might jump smartly and show what he can really do.''
